Target audience
Those who wish to assess, evaluate, and apply emerging information systems (IS) technology to business.
Those who wish to take an active role in systems development to create an IS that meets their needs.
Those who need to learn how to employ IS to accomplish their job tasks.
Those who want to use IS to achieve their business strategies.

Course programme
- Functions and organisation of the IS department
- How do organisations plan the use of IS?
- Advantages and disadvantages of outsourcing
- User rights and responsibilities
Upon completion of this course, you will be able to understand:
- The primary responsibilities of the IS department.
- The reasons for outsourcing IS services, the most common and popular outsource alternatives, and the outsourcing risks.
- The rights and responsibilities regarding services provided by the IS department.
